The control panels on the most recent dishwashers can look intimidating. They're loaded with so many dials, push buttons, and other options that the machine seems to be too complicated to repair. This is actually not the case. With the exception of the control panel, dishwashers have not modified a lot in basic design over the past two decades. You possibly can repair most dishwasher malfunctions your self, and we'll discuss tips for do-it-yourself service and upkeep in this article. Dishwasher components could be replaced as a unit, which is often simpler and inexpensive than having a professional service person make repairs. If you are not certain an element continues to be usable, remove it from the dishwasher and take it to an expert for testing.
You'll be able to then decide whether or not to purchase a brand new part or have the previous one repaired on the idea of the repair estimate. For best dishwashing results, set the temperature control of the water heater to no lower than 140 levels Farenheit. Water cooler than this often would not get the dishes clean, until your dishwasher is a newer model that preheats incoming water. The water shutoff for the dishwasher is often positioned beneath the adjoining sink. Before doing any work on the dishwasher, make certain the unit is unplugged or the power to the unit is turned off, and take away the fuse or journey the circuit breaker that controls the circuit at the main entrance panel or at a separate panel.
Shut off the water provide to the dishwasher on the shutoff in the basement or crawl house below the kitchen. If the unit plugs right into a wall outlet, verify the cord, the plug, and the outlet to verify they're functioning properly. Also check the change that controls the outlet to ensure it is turned on. Most constructed-in dishwashers are wired immediately right into a circuit. Check the primary entrance panel for a blown fuse or tripped circuit breaker, and restore the circuit.
